This patch is a part of a series that extends arm64 kernel ABI to allow to
pass tagged user pointers (with the top byte set to something else other
than 0x00) as syscall arguments.
find_active_uprobe() uses user pointers (obtained via
instruction_pointer(regs)) for vma lookups, which can only by done with
untagged pointers.
Untag user pointers in this function.

Similarly here, that's a breakpoint address, hence instruction pointer
(PC) which is untagged.
